Common causes of foot pain and discomfort:

Plantar Fasciitis
Inflammation of the plantar fascia, often due to overuse, improper footwear, or biomechanical issues. Causes heel pain, especially in the morning or after prolonged periods of rest. Learn more about plantar fasciitis treatment.
Achilles Tendinitis
Overuse or repetitive stress on the Achilles tendon, common in runners or athletes. Causes pain and stiffness along the back of the foot towards the heel, especially after physical activity. Discover Achilles tendinitis treatment options.
Flat Feet (Pes Planus)
Lack of arch support due to genetic factors, injury, or muscle weakness. Causes pain and fatigue, often in the arch or heel.
When Foot Pain Needs Urgent Care
Most foot pain can be safely assessed and managed by our GP team. However, please seek medical attention promptly – or visit an Emergency Department – if you experience:
- Severe foot pain after a fall, crush injury, or direct trauma
- Visible deformity of the foot, inability to bear weight, or severe swelling
- Signs of infection such as redness, warmth, swelling, or drainage from the foot
- Severe swelling that restricts blood flow (foot turning pale, blue, or feeling numb)
- Sudden loss of sensation or severe tingling and numbness in the foot
In the above instances, it would be highly recommended by doctors to rule out serious foot conditions such as fracture, tendon rupture, vascular compromise, or joint infection through appropriate imaging and specialist assessment. Early identification and treatment of acute foot injuries is essential to prevent permanent loss of function.

Physiotherapy for Foot Pain
Available in-house at both Holland Village and Katong.
Physiotherapy for foot pain may include:
- Ultrasound Therapy – stimulates healing in foot structures, promoting tissue repair and effective management of foot pain and injuries
- Exercise Prescriptions – prescribed exercises and stretching programmes improve foot strength, flexibility, and mobility, providing pain relief and supporting the healing process of foot injuries
- Deep Tissue Massage – targets deeper muscle layers and connective tissue in the foot, relieving chronic pain, reducing muscle tension, and improving blood flow to aid in injury recovery
- Electrotherapy – modalities like transcutaneous electrical nerve stimulation (TENS) alleviate foot pain by altering pain signals and promoting the release of endorphins
- Posture and Gait Education – education on proper foot mechanics, walking patterns, and body positioning minimises strain on the foot, including recommendations to prevent foot pain and injuries
- Sports Physio for Foot Pain – tailored programmes for foot pain occurring during sports activities such as running, basketball, soccer, and tennis, designed to relieve pain, target the unique stresses these sports place on the foot, and reduce the risk of recurring injury
